Dell's Strong AI Momentum Fuels Bullish Option Sentiment
The market is bullish on Dell (DELL) due to record Q2 earnings driven by strong AI server demand. The stock hit a new 52-week high, fueled by positive analyst commentary and upgrades. Option pricing reflects this optimism with elevated implied volatility and a term structure that slopes backward.

Three-month outlook
Bullish bias from $95B AI backlog visibility, raised Q3/FY guidance (ISG +145% in Q3), operating leverage, and analyst upgrades, with potential 10-20%+ upside toward $600-650 if execution holds and AI demand persists. High uncertainty from premium valuation (P/E 31 vs growth), supply chain/memory chip constraints, hardware margin risks, insider selling, possible AI hype fade, and market volatility; downside to $450-500 if backlog conversion disappoints or broader tech pullback. Market sentiment context
Predominantly bullish on AI infrastructure leadership, new ATH, strong earnings/backlog, and sector momentum vs peers like SMCI; posts highlight breakout, institutional interest, and long-term AI play. Caution/mixed views include overbought RSI, weekly bearish divergence (higher highs/lower RSI), hesitation at current levels after huge YTD run (~300%+), valuation concerns, insider selling, and some short interest targeting.
